Ham and Cheese Muffins:

Ingredients:

  • 1-3/4 cups of flour
  • 3 tablespoons of sugar
  • 1 tablespoon of baking powder
  • 1 cup of milk
  • 3 tablespoons of vegetable oil
  • 1 egg, beaten
  • 1 cup of shredded cheddar cheese
  • 3/4 cups of smoked ham, chopped into little pieces

Directions:

Those of you who follow my recipe already know that I start each cooking or baking task with getting all ingredients ready – believe me – if you develop the same habit, you will enjoy working in your kitchen even more!

Mix together flour, sugar and baking powder in a large bowl and milk, oil and beaten egg in a smaller bowl

Make a well in the centre of dry ingredients, pour in your milk mixture and blend together until the batter is uniform

Carefully fold in your chopped ham and shredded cheddar cheese – mix until just uniformly blended. If you find the batter too thick, add a little milk.

Spoon batter into prepared muffin pan – I used mini muffin pan to make the muffins more of a snack style. I also sprayed the pan with non-stick coating to make sure my muffins come out of the pan easily

Bake at 400F oven for about 15 – 20 minutes, or until the muffins tops are nice and golden. Remove from pan when they are slightly cooled and serve warm
